"My Oxford Year is an achingly beautiful debut." Robinne Lee, author of The Idea of You

"My Oxford Year is a pure delight with unpredictable depths. Julia Whelan has crafted a story that is as fun and charming as it is powerful and wise. Ella Durran is a breath of fresh air and her story will stay with you long after you're done." Taylor Jenkins Reid, author of The Seven Husbands of Evelyn Hugo

"My Oxford Year is a funny, tender, heart-breaking coming-of-age adventure." Allison Winn Scotch, New York Times bestselling author

"Full of humor and romance, MY OXFORD YEAR has it all-I loved it!"Jill Shalvis, New York Times bestselling author.

    5 Stars from me <3

    This one? Pure comfort. Like a warm drink on a rainy day or a soft blanket wrapped around your heart. The Oxford Year is cute, fluffy, and full of that delicious “American girl goes to England and accidentally falls into feelings” trope—and I ate it up. No regrets. Until it is not. Then it gets the Jojo Moyes „Me Before You“ Vibes. And then the funny story turned sad really fast. I listened to the audiobook, which is read by Julia Whelan herself (because apparently being a talented writer and a dreamy narrator is just something she does), and let me tell you—her voice brings it to life in such a unique, grounded way. Total bonus points there. The story itself is easy to love: smart American girl Ella heads to Oxford with political dreams and a don’t-look-at-me-I’m-focused mindset… until she meets a very charming local boy with secrets of his own. You think you know where it’s going—and in some ways, you do—but then- you really don‘t. There were couple of things that truly stuck with me: the way Jamie talks with his mom and their line they have. The relationship between father and son- which had a beautiful climax and made me cry. A solid 5 Star book.

    unvorhergesehene Wendung

    Die erste Hälfte des Buches hat mir ausgesprochen gut gefallen. Wunderbare Beschreibungen von Oxford, lebendige Charaktere und eine schöne Geschichte. In der zweiten Hälfte ging es dann um Jamies Geheimnis (SPOILER): eine schwere Krankheit. Ab hier wurde das Buch dann sehr ernst und auch emotionaler. Trotzdem gut geschrieben. Allerdings werde ich als Leser gerne vorgewarnt (z.B. auf dem Klappentext), bevor ich ein Buch mit einem solchen Inhalt lese.

    A heartfelt journey through Oxford

    Ella and Jamie are honestly so sweet together. I really didn’t expect Jamie to be sick, that completely caught me off guard. I felt so sorry for Ella, though. She didn’t deserve to be lied to, even if Jamie had his reasons. That said, I do think they got together very quickly and almost a bit forcefully. Yes, they had wanted to be together for a long time, but making it official so soon after she found out about his illness? That felt rushed to me. What I really appreciated, though, was the moment Ella realized that her plans weren’t actually what she wanted anymore. Sometimes life just turns out differently than we imagined. I’m usually not a fan of open endings, but here I actually liked that we don’t find out when Jamie dies. It made the story feel more real somehow.
